On Tuesday night, Indiana defeated Penn State 74-70 at Simon Skjodt Assembly Hall. After the game, our crew broke it all down on The Assembly Call IU Postgame Show. Among the topics discussed: -- How Juwan Morgan, once again, took over for Indiana in key stretches, set then tone on the glass, and generally just continued his ascension to star status. -- The importance of Josh Newkirk and Devonte Green stepping up on a night when Robert Johnson's decision making was ... curious (at best). -- Why Justin Smith struggled to back up his breakout performance. -- Indiana's impressive work on the glass for the second straight game, as the Hoosiers have clearly responded to Archie calling them "soft." -- What is different for IU now that De'Ron Davis is out, and how sustainable the Hoosiers' success without Davis might be. -- Is this the template for Devonte Green to become a more consistent member of the rotation? We also point out a few meaningful moments you may have missed, go inside the numbers, and hand out our game balls. All of that, and more, on this edition of The Assembly Call.
